在当今互联网时代,数据库管理工具如 PHPMyAdmin 对于开发者来说至关重要,在使用 PHPMyAdmin 时,我们可能会遇到各种问题,其中最常见的就是“内部服务器错误”,本文将深入探讨这一问题的原因、潜在影响以及解决方法。
图片来源于网络,如有侵权联系删除
PHPMyAdmin 是一款流行的开源 Web 管理界面,用于管理和维护 MySQL 和 MariaDB 数据库,它提供了直观的用户界面,使得数据库操作变得简单易行,有时候在使用 PHPMyAdmin 过程中,我们会遇到“内部服务器错误”这样的提示信息,这种错误不仅影响了我们的工作效率,还可能对数据安全造成威胁,了解和解决这一问题显得尤为重要。
内部服务器错误的成因分析
-
权限不足 PHPMyAdmin 在访问数据库时需要相应的权限,如果用户的账户没有足够的权限来执行某些操作,就会导致内部服务器错误,尝试删除或修改数据库中的数据时,如果没有相应的权限,系统会返回错误。
-
配置文件问题 PHPMyAdmin 的配置文件(通常为
config.inc.php
)包含了数据库连接的相关设置,如果这些设置不正确或者被篡改,可能会导致内部服务器错误,常见的配置问题包括主机名、端口、用户名和密码等信息的错误。 -
版本兼容性问题 PHPMyAdmin 与 PHP 版本之间存在一定的依赖关系,如果使用的 PHP 版本与 PHPMyAdmin 不兼容,那么就会出现内部服务器错误,不同版本的 PHPMyAdmin 也可能存在一些bug,这些问题在某些情况下会导致内部服务器错误。
-
插件冲突 许多开发者喜欢使用 PHPMyAdmin 插件来扩展其功能,这些插件之间可能会发生冲突,从而导致内部服务器错误,特别是当多个插件同时加载时,它们之间的相互干扰更容易引发此类问题。
-
服务器负载过高 当服务器的资源消耗达到极限时,即使是最基本的请求也可能无法得到及时响应,从而产生内部服务器错误,这种情况通常发生在高并发环境下,如大量用户同时访问网站或进行数据处理时。
应对策略及优化措施
图片来源于网络,如有侵权联系删除
-
检查权限 首先要确保当前登录的用户具有足够的权限来执行所需的数据库操作,可以通过更改用户角色或增加新用户的方式来解决这个问题。
-
验证配置文件 定期检查并更新
config.inc.php
文件中的所有参数值,确保它们都是正确的且符合当前的数据库环境,同时注意备份原始文件以防止意外丢失。 -
升级到最新版 如果发现某个特定版本的 PHPMyAdmin 存在已知漏洞或缺陷,建议尽快升级到最新的稳定版,这不仅有助于修复已知的错误,还能提升整体的安全性。
-
谨慎添加插件 在安装和使用插件时要格外小心,避免引入不必要的风险,对于已经存在的插件,定期评估其必要性和安全性,必要时考虑卸载多余或不稳定的插件。
-
监控服务器性能 通过专业的监控工具实时监测服务器的CPU、内存和网络带宽等关键指标的变化情况,一旦发现异常波动,立即采取措施进行调整和处理。
“内部服务器错误”是 PHPMyAdmin 使用过程中较为常见的一个问题,虽然其原因多样且复杂,但只要我们掌握了有效的排查方法和对应的解决方案,就能轻松应对这类挑战,在实际工作中,我们应该保持警惕,及时发现并解决问题,以确保系统的稳定运行和数据的安全存储。
标签: #phpmyadmin 内部服务器错误
评论列表